Essential Responsibilities:
Plan & procedures:
- Ensuring all relevant system engineering procedures are in place
- Assisting with and/or producing system engineering deliverables in accordance with contractual requirements, relevant Laws, Rules, Regulations, Codes & standards
- Assisting with /or produce schedule of activities for system engineering, assist in managing system engineering changes
System Design:
- Develop the SPS Design basis, overall Functional Design Specification, system P&IDs, field layouts
- Ensuring that the master equipment list is technically sound and producing the SDRL
- Checking & approving documentation & providing technical requirements for SIT
- Be an active member of the Offshore Coordination Team
- Manage and resolve system engineering interfaces
- Assist the CoEs in providing necessary technical systems information
- Ensure delivery of all required flow assurance, erosion, thermal and vibration analysis, required materials selection strategies and Cathodic protection philosophy
Qualification and verification:
- Follow up of technical qualification programs, ensuring designs alignment with results
- Reviewing equipment qualification status and developing the qualification test plan
- Establish and follow-up design Verification Plan
- Assisting/ producing Readiness Review documentation to check the maturity of projects
Technical Assurance:
- Assist development and Management of the technical risks register and engineering risk
- Coordinating support for customer engineering activities and Installation reviews
- Ensuring that all activities are defined & planned for as per Contract and documentation is delivered
